What is a firmware engineer remote internship?

A Firmware Engineer Remote Internship is a temporary, often entry-level position where interns work remotely to assist in the development, testing, and debugging of firmware—low-level software that controls hardware devices. Interns typically learn to write code for embedded systems, collaborate with hardware and software teams, and gain hands-on experience with tools and technologies used in firmware engineering. The remote aspect allows interns to work from anywhere, making the opportunity accessible to a wider range of candidates. These internships are valuable for gaining practical skills and industry experience in embedded systems and firmware development.

What are the key skills and qualifications needed to thrive as a firmware engineer remote intern?

To excel as a Firmware Engineer Remote Intern, you typically need a solid understanding of embedded systems, C/C++ programming, and a background in electrical or computer engineering. Familiarity with hardware debuggers, microcontroller development environments (such as Keil or MPLAB), and version control systems like Git is important. Strong problem-solving abilities, self-motivation, and effective remote communication skills help set candidates apart. These competencies ensure you can efficiently contribute to firmware development, collaborate in distributed teams, and adapt to the fast-paced technology landscape.

What challenges might I face as a remote firmware engineer intern, and how can I effectively collaborate with the team?

As a remote Firmware Engineer intern, you may encounter challenges such as limited access to physical hardware for testing, time zone differences with team members, and less immediate feedback compared to in-person settings. To collaborate effectively, it's important to communicate proactively, participate actively in virtual meetings, and use version control and collaboration tools like Git and Slack. Many teams also set up remote access to hardware labs or provide simulation environments, so being resourceful and asking questions will help you overcome obstacles and stay engaged with your project and team.

About the Role

This role owns PoP network architecture and interconnection, the hardware platform, and the PoP deployment process, with responsibilities shared across the team according to individual strengths. The role spans internet connectivity and BGP policy, hardware selection and lifecycle, datacenter management, and the staging, turn-up, and acceptance procedures executed with junior engineering staff.


What You'll Do

  • Design PoP network topology, including redundancy and resilience, and validate failover behavior through testing.
  • Manage internet transit providers: selection, port sizing, diversity planning, SLA (Service Level Agreement) tracking, and escalation.
  • Manage interconnection end to end: cross-connect ordering and lifecycle with colocation providers, IXP (Internet Exchange Point) participation, and peering coordination.
  • Define and maintain BGP policy: route filtering, communities, traffic engineering, and DDoS (Distributed Denial of Service) mitigation including blackholing.
  • Administer internet number resources: RIR (Regional Internet Registry) allocations, ASN (Autonomous System Number) records, IRR (Internet Routing Registry) objects, and RPKI/ROA (Resource Public Key Infrastructure / Route Origin Authorization).
  • Monitor bandwidth utilization, forecast capacity, and plan upgrades.
  • Maintain the hardware BoM (Bill of Materials): validated configurations, available options, and qualification of new platforms and components.
  • Maintain firmware baselines (system, management controller, network adapters) with staged rollout and rollback procedures.
  • Own hardware monitoring, maintenance, and hardware issue escalations from the Operations Engineering team.
  • Maintain hardware inventory accuracy: serial numbers, asset tags, locations, warranty status, spares levels, and RMA (Return Merchandise Authorization) tracking.
  • Manage vendor and colocation relationships: quotes, contracts, lead times, EOL/EOS (End of Life / End of Sale) tracking, rack space, power budgets, and remote-hands procedures.
  • Own the PoP deployment process: staging plans, burn-in criteria, configuration and firmware baselining prior to shipment, turn-up procedures, and production acceptance.
  • Develop and maintain the acceptance test suite, with defined pass/fail criteria gating handover to operations.
  • Validate hardware and network configurations against approved standards prior to production. (Replace Linux with Kubia)
  • Provide daily technical direction, task assignment, and quality review for junior engineers performing staging, shipping, and turn-up work.
  • Identify and eliminate manual steps in the deployment process.
